Michael said:
I am wondering why more than one rundll32.exe file is
showing up in task manager/processes?

Rundll32 is the program used to run a DLL library file as if it were a
program. There may be several such dlls being run in this way.
Unfortunately Task manager can get no further than the host program, not
to the dll concerned. One example would be running shimgvw.dll to
preview picture files
